KITCHARI

Kitchari is a delicious one pot meal that is nourishing, but easy to digest. It's a great food to eat during times of stress, if the body is weak or if the digestions is off. Kitchari Recipe

Prep time: about 1 hour

Wash well:

½ cup basmati rice (white is easier to digest)

½ cup split mung dahl (yellow, small split bean from Indian grocer or health food store)

Place in medium saucepan with:

4 cups water

1 tsp ghee (clarified butter can be purchased in a jar or use this Ghee Recipe)


Prepare by washing and chopping:

2 carrots sliced

1 tender zucchini

any other vegetable you like

Cook rice, mung beans, water and ghee for 45 minutes, then add vegetables and cover for 10-15 minutes or until the veggies are well cooked.


In a separate skillet heat:

1 Tablespoon of ghee

½ teaspoon coriander

½ teaspoon cumin

½ teaspoon ginger

½ teaspoon turmeric

salt to taste

Heat ghee, spices and salt until you smell the beautiful aroma, then pour over rice and dal mixture and stir well.


This recipe can be made either thick or soupy and with a variety of vegetable and spices as per the season.


It’s also okay to add fresh squeezed lime and cilantro or basil just before enjoying!


Recipe from the Kripalu Center for Yoga and Health
